Now we grow onions, potatoes, turnip, beetroot, parsnips, carrots, leeks, chives, wild garlic, mint, stawberries, rhubarb & rasperries. We seem unable to grow cabbage, bussels or cauliflower - never get hearts - perhaps too much nitrogen in the soil as veg plot used to be a chicken run.
